Output 85deca4ace339463d9d0afa89a343dca17f02ddc42deb89d9d054a64532bedf2:5

value
17528980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e99addfe85b0e8356350bd6f8cf92584da188e8 OP_EQUAL
address
MDcAE9ANMefKwZV6wvHDsMeJjnkVTQ2U6W
transaction
85deca4ace339463d9d0afa89a343dca17f02ddc42deb89d9d054a64532bedf2
spent
true